APGA demands immediate prosecution of Abia govt appointee over death threat
By Steve Oko
The All Progressive Grand Alliance, APGA, in Abia State, has commended the Department of State Services, DSS for quizzing the Abia State Director of Signage and Advertisement Agency (ABSAA), Mr Tony Otuonye over his murderous threats against anyone that would not vote for the governorship candidate of the ruling Peoples Democratic Party (PDP), Chief Okey Ahiwe.
APGA, however, demanded the immediate prosecution of the suspect and his accomplices, arguing that justice delayed is justice denied.
Wawa News Global had reported that Otuonye was arrested on Monday by the DSS and later granted Administrative bail after he was grilled by the Secret Police.
DSS Director in the state, Mr Friday Onuche told our Correspondent that Otuonye would be reporting daily at the DSS headquarters, adding that he is not yet off the hook.
Chairman of APGA in the state, Rev. Augustine Ehiemere, in a press statement, tasked the State Police Command to begin from where the DSS had stopped by arraigning Otuonye and his cohorts before the court.
APGA expressed shock that a highly-placed appointee of the State Government like Otuonye could brazenly be spewing out murderous threats against innocent citizens.
According to APGA, immediate prosecution of Otuonye and his foot soldiers as well as sponsors will ensure a hitch-free governorship and house of assembly elections on Saturday.
APGA further called for a through investigation of allegations and counter allegations of alleged importation of armed thugs into the state for the purpose of using them to intimidate voters on Saturday.
According to APGA, if armed thugs hidden in Governor’s lodge in one of the sister states in the South East could be nabbed in a sting military operation, nothing should be left to chances.
APGA which stressed that the forthcoming elections are not worth the life of any Abian, urged security agencies to be on top of their game.
